Genetic deletion of β3 integrin abrogates activity of tumstatin peptide. (A) RT2 mice were implanted s.c. with Matrigel plugs at 9 wk of age and treated with tumstatin daily as described above for 1 wk. The Matrigel plugs were then harvested; six plugs were assayed in each group. (B) An intervention trial comparing tumstatin and endostatin peptides in RT2/β3 Integrin−/− mice treated from 10 to 13.5 wk of age. The tumstatin peptide (control, n = 7; tumstatin peptide, n = 7) did not prevent tumor growth in the absence of β3 integrin, whereas the endostatin peptide (control, n = 3; endostatin peptide, n = 4) significantly inhibited tumor growth in RT2/β3 integrin−/− mice. Results are shown as mean ± SEM; *P < 0.05.
